Identifying Peak Mosquito Months

Identifying Peak Mosquito Months is crucial for effective mosquito control. Understanding the regional variations and climate impact on mosquito activity can help determine the best time for mosquito spraying.

Regional Variations

Peak mosquito months vary by region:

RegionPeak Months
Gulf Coast, Florida, and HawaiiFebruary through November
South and SouthwestMarch through September
Mid-Atlantic, Midwest, and WestApril through September
New England, Northern Midwest, and Pacific NorthwestMay through September

Climate Impact On Mosquito Activity

  • Mosquito activity is influenced by climate.
  • Warmer temperatures and higher humidity contribute to increased mosquito activity.
  • Springtime marks the beginning of mosquito season in many areas, making it an ideal time for mosquito spraying.

Eliminating Standing Water

Standing water serves as a breeding ground for mosquitoes, making it essential to eliminate any stagnant water sources around your property. This can be achieved by regularly emptying containers such as flower pots, bird baths, and gutters, where water tends to accumulate. Additionally, ensuring proper drainage in your yard can prevent the formation of puddles and stagnant areas that attract mosquitoes.

Using Mosquito Repellent Plants

Incorporating mosquito repellent plants into your landscaping can serve as a natural deterrent for mosquitoes. Plants such as lavender, citronella, and lemongrass emit fragrances that repel mosquitoes, creating a more unwelcoming environment for these pests. By strategically placing these plants around your outdoor living spaces, you can discourage mosquitoes from lingering in the vicinity.

Proper Spraying Techniques

Utilizing the correct spraying techniques is vital for ensuring that the insecticide is applied effectively to target mosquito breeding and resting sites. Here are the proper spraying techniques to maximize the impact of mosquito control:

  • Targeted Application: Direct the spray towards areas where mosquitoes are known to breed and rest, such as stagnant water, bushes, and dense foliage.
  • Uniform Coverage: Ensure thorough and even coverage of the designated areas to maximize the effectiveness of the insecticide.
  • Optimal Timing: Conduct spraying during the early morning or late afternoon when mosquitoes are most active, ensuring better exposure to the insecticide.
  • Appropriate Dilution: Follow the manufacturer’s instructions to dilute the insecticide correctly for optimal efficacy and safety.
  • Safe Disposal: Dispose of any leftover insecticide and clean the equipment properly to prevent environmental contamination and ensure safety.

Frequently Asked Questions

What Months Are The Worst For Mosquitoes?

The worst months for mosquitoes vary by region: Gulf Coast, Florida, and Hawaii – February through November. South and Southwest – March through September. Mid-Atlantic, Midwest, and West – April through September. New England, Northern Midwest, and Pacific Northwest – May through September.

How Often Should You Spray For Ticks And Mosquitoes?

For optimal protection, spray for ticks and mosquitoes every 2-3 weeks during peak season.

Where Is The Best Place To Spray For Mosquitoes?

The best place to spray for mosquitoes is at mosquito resting sites like the sides of homes, around doorways, tall grass, shrubs, and backyard trees.
